How to Make Enemies Surrender
Before we get into the art of making your enemies surrender in Half Sword, make sure they’re either downed, cornered, exhausted, or disarmed. With that said, there are two ways to make your enemies surrender in Half Sword, and here’s what they are:
Taunting Enemies
You can easily make enemies surrender by putting your opponent to the ground, approaching them, and repeatedly pressing G on your keyboard. This will make your character spew taunts at the opponent. After a short while, the enemy will start begging for mercy, which means you’ve successfully made them surrender.
While it’s a convenient method to make them surrender, it may not work every time. Having your opponent downed is a critical step before you can make them surrender.
Pressing a Weapon Against Their Face
The next method to make enemies surrender quickly is by pressing your weapon against their face. In this method, you don’t need to hurl insults; all you have to do is get close, push them to the ground, and keep your weapon pressed against their face.
Shortly, the enemy will start begging for mercy, and you’ll win the battle without bloodshed. Just ensure that the enemy is on the ground, or on the verge of falling, before you attempt to make them surrender.

FAQs
Can the enemy recover after surrendering?
If they manage to gain enough confidence after the surrender, they can pick up their weapon and resume fighting, so keep your weapon trained on them to avoid it.
Will disarming their weapons guarantee a surrender?
While surrender isn’t a guaranteed mechanic, it makes it easier for the enemies to give up if they lose their weapons.
Do killing blows prevent surrender?
Yes, lethal hits will immediately remove any chance of your enemies surrendering, since they’re killed.
Does weapon choice affect surrender chances?
Longer weapons, such as Great Swords, Hallberds, Spears, or Axes, can make surrender more likely, but it’s not guaranteed.
Can I surrender in Half Sword?
Yes, you can easily surrender or exit combat by pressing and holding G on your keyboard.
